About the role and about You:
The Senior Data Analyst / Analytics Engineer is a key member of the Data Analytics team reporting to the Director of Data and FP&A. A strong candidate will be comfortable partnering directly with stakeholders across the business will enjoy working with autonomy and will show a very high level of curiosity. Our Data Analytics team is expected to have a good understanding of the whole business frequently flexing across multiple domains. Your initial core responsibilities will be focused on partnership with our eCommerce and Marketing teams.
What youll do:
- Partner with a variety of stakeholders to track performance share insights and ultimately influence strategic decision-making.
- Design measurement frameworks and perform in-depth analysis to evaluate the impact of new initiatives campaigns and strategic company objectives.
- Produce high quality data models dashboards and ad hoc reports to support business performance analysis and decision-making.
- Collaborate with the Data Engineering team and Software Engineers to produce new well-governed datasets tools and products that will enable team members and internal customers to use data with confidence.
- Support teams to design launch monitor analyze and report on A/B multivariate and campaign incrementality tests.
- Prioritize your workload and support team members to balance delivery of proactive and practical insights with a timely turnaround on ad hoc requests that are aligned to key company initiatives.
- Collaborate with data analytics peers with a range of experience levels acting as an intellectual sparring partner and reviewing each others work.
What were looking for:
- Bachelors or Masters degree in a quantitative field such as Data Science Statistics Computer Science Mathematics Economics or a related discipline.
- 2 years of experience in data analytics data science or advanced analytical roles.
- Expert-level SQL and strong expertise in data modeling and analytics engineering best practices.
- Excellent knowledge of data visualization and analysis tools such as Tableau Amplitude and Databricks.
- Strategic thinker with a hands-on approach able to manage competing priorities deliver on key initiatives and drive measurable results within a fast-paced high-growth environment.
- Must be organized self-motivated resourceful curious and proactive.
Bonus points:
- Experience in technology gaming ecommerce or subscription businesses are an advantage.
- Google Analytics Google Tag Manager SEO and other upper funnel marketing tools.
- Advanced analytics methods including familiarity with Python.
